Ogoja Council Boss Greets CR PDP Chair At 62

Ogoja Local Government Council boss, Rita Agbo Ayim has congratulated, the State Chairman of the People’s Democratic Party (PDP), Ntufam John Achort Okon, on the occasion of his 62nd Birthday Celebration.

In her congratulatory message to the People’s Democratic Party State Chairman, Ayim described Ntufam Okon as a man who has played positive roles that have aided the evolution of the party and the attainment of her present enviable and peaceful position. The council boss further noted that the celebrant’s life has been spent in the pursuit of human development and promotion of virtues anchored on improvement of all facets of life, especially in the party and thanked God for using him as a tool to reposition the party for posterity.

She minced no words in describing the Party Chairman as a man of many parts, a bureaucrat, a politician, a man of vision, wisdom, courage, humility and a source of inspiration to all who come by him. She was particular that Ntufam Okon’s loyalty was tested during the last Local Government Election in the State and he did not falter, leading the party instead to a clean sweep of all the seats as well as giving women and youths the opportunity to serve their people through elective and appointive positions. The council boss ended by wishing Okon all the best in life as he continues his good work.
